Miles Russell, 15, to play Rocket Mortgage Classic


Russell will be among the youngest players ever to make their debut on the PGA TOUR. The record belongs to Michelle Wie West, who was granted a sponsor exemption to play in the 2004 Sony Open at the age of 14 years, 3 months and 4 days. Wie West also became the fourth woman to play a TOUR event. Guan (2013 Masters), Andy Zhang (2012 U.S. Open) and Lorens Chan (2009 Sony Open) also debuted at 14 years old. Other 15-year-olds to play TOUR events have included John Oda (2012 Sony Open), Tadd Fujikawa (2006 U.S. Open) and Bob Pasanik (1957 Canadian Open).
